What is Bangladesh’s Independence Day?

Bangladesh’s declaration of freedom from Pakistan in 1971 was celebrated as Freedom Day on March 26. It honours the start of the country’s fight for freedom, which was caused by years of political and cultural abuse. People remember the bravery of the leaders and freedom fighters who first worked to make the country independent on this day.

Most of the time, people celebrate by raising flags, having parades, and holding cultural events that honour how strong the people are. Special programs that show how hard Bangladesh has worked for freedom are also done in schools and government offices.

What does Bangladesh’s Victory Day celebrate?

Victory Day is on December 16 and celebrates the end of the Bangladesh Liberation War in 1971. On this day, the Pakistani military gave up to the joint forces of Bangladesh and India. This ended the nine-month-long war in favour of the Bangladesh-Indian alliance.

Victory Day is not the same as Independence Day, which is about starting to fight for freedom. Victory Day celebrates the nation’s success and final victory. It is a day to be proud and think about all the people who gave up so much to free the country.

Key Differences Between the Two Days

AspectIndependence DayVictory Day
DateMarch 26December 16
SignificanceDeclaration of independenceSuccessful end of the liberation war
FocusBeginning of the freedom struggleCelebration of victory and national pride
CelebrationsFlag hoisting, parades, speechesMilitary parades, ceremonies, paying tribute to martyrs

Why Each Day is Important

Independence Day and Victory Day are both very important to what it means to be Bangladeshi. Independence Day tells people of how brave they were to fight for their freedom, and Victory Day celebrates the end of that fight. These days represent the path of the country from oppression to independence and the unity of its people in reaching a common goal.
